Born in New York City in 1934, Carol Kelly was out of a performing family that also included sister Nancy Kelly and brother Jack Kelly, both of whom enjoyed long screen and television careers. Carol, though, not so much and her only prominent assignment came in Terror in a Texas Town 1958), a low budget but quite interesting western starring Sterling Hayden, directed by cult phenomenon Joseph H. Lewis and penned by actor Nedrick Young.
